登录
首页 >  Golang >  Go问答

有没有 Go 语言版本的轻量级 Firebase Admin SDK 只包含 auth 功能?

来源:stackoverflow

时间:2024-03-27 20:27:24 265浏览 收藏

知识点掌握了,还需要不断练习才能熟练运用。下面golang学习网给大家带来一个Golang开发实战,手把手教大家学习《有没有 Go 语言版本的轻量级 Firebase Admin SDK 只包含 auth 功能?》,在实现功能的过程中也带大家重新温习相关知识点,温故而知新,回头看看说不定又有不一样的感悟!

问题内容

我将整个 firebase.google.com/go/v4 库作为依赖项,以便能够执行以下操作:

client *auth.Client
client.VerifyIDToken(ctx, bearerToken)

是否有仅包含 auth 包的 firebase 库的轻量版本?或者更好的是,这只是进行 firebase id 令牌验证。


正确答案


Go 版 Firebase Admin SDK 只有一个版本,它包含 SDK 支持的所有 Firebase 功能的客户端。与客户端 SDK 不同,各个 Firebase 功能没有单独的管理 SDK。

如果您不想使用 Admin SDK for Go,您可以:

  • 编写代码直接与 REST API 对话。
  • 获取 code of the SDK,看看是否可以构建仅包含您需要的内容的精简版本。

以上就是《有没有 Go 语言版本的轻量级 Firebase Admin SDK 只包含 auth 功能?》的详细内容,更多关于的资料请关注golang学习网公众号!

声明:本文转载于:stackoverflow 如有侵犯,请联系study_golang@163.com删除
相关阅读
更多>
最新阅读
更多>
课程推荐
更多>